Job Description & How to Apply Below
You’ll lead on complex employee relations matters, develop and embed HR policies, and provide expert guidance to leaders and managers. This is a hands-on role with strategic influence, offering variety, autonomy, and the opportunity to make a real impact.
Key Responsibilities:
Case Management Lead on all complex HR casework including disciplinary, grievance, capability, absence, and safeguarding-related matters. Provide expert advice to Managers and senior leaders on employment law and best practice. Ensure timely and accurate documentation, investigation processes, and outcomes. Liaise with legal advisors and unions as required. Maintain the casework tracker and produce regular reports for SLT HR Policy Development Review and update HR policies in line with statutory changes.
Consult with all stakeholders including union representatives. Ensure policies are accessible, user-friendly, and embedded through training and communication. Lead on the development of toolkits, templates, and flowcharts to support policy implementation. Training & Support Deliver training and briefings to leaders and line managers on HR policies and case management. Support with bespoke advice and coaching on handling sensitive HR matters.
Develop FAQs and guidance notes to build confidence and consistency across the business. Strategic Contribution Contribute to workforce planning, change management, and organisational development initiatives. Support the HR Director in developing a proactive, responsive HR service. Analyse trends in casework and policy usage to inform strategic decision QUALIFICATIONS & SKILLS REQUIRED CIPD qualified or equivalent experience. Strong knowledge of employment law and best practice.
Excellent communication, coaching, and influencing skills. Experience managing complex casework and policy development. Ability to work collaboratively across multiple sites and stakeholders. Driving licence
